Located in the heart of Manhattan, Hunter College, the largest senior college in the City University of New York system, allows students to easily immerse themselves in all the city has to offer. Hunter offers over 170 areas of study across six schools at the undergraduate, graduate and doctoral levels. The most popular majors include psychology, human biology and computer science. Hunter has over 10 centers and institutes for undergraduates to work in, from research on sustainable cities to healthy aging. The college encourages students to participate in some of the over 120 clubs by stopping classes for two hours each week so student organizations can meet. The NCAA Division III Hunter Hawks have produced seven Olympians and 54 all-American athletes. Hunter has six honors programs that offer merit scholarships and are based on academic themes, including visual and performing arts and nursing. Students are given the opportunity to live in the residence halls across Manhattans East Side. Although 84% of students are from New York City, 156 countries are represented among the student body, with the most coming from China, the Dominican Republic and Bangladesh. About 75% of students graduate without debt. Actor Vin Diesel attended Hunter, as well as two Nobel laureates and five Pulitzer Prize winners.

Founded in 1881, University of the Incarnate Word is a private Catholic institution. It operates an all-girls high school, Incarnate Word High School, as well as a co-educational high school, St. Anthony Catholic High School. It also operates two elementary schools, St. Anthony's and St. Peter Prince of the Apostles, through its Brainpower Connection program. It offers 90 undergraduate programs, 23 intercollegiate sports, and opportunities for service learning and global study. The company is headquartered in San Antonio, Texas.
